The Fragonard Girl scene from the cabaret show Playtime at the Piccadilly, at the Piccadilly Hotel, London, 1925 - costumes by Dolly Tree Date: 1925

Step into the vibrant world of 1920s London nightlife with this image from the cabaret show 'Playtime' at the Piccadilly Hotel. The Fragonard Girl scene, a popular act in the production, is depicted here in all its jazz age glory. The elegant and enigmatic performer, dressed in a stunning costume designed by the renowned Dolly Tree, poses seductively against a backdrop of rich, Art Deco-inspired set design. The Fragonard Girl, a reference to the famous 18th-century painting 'The Swing' by Jean-Honoré Fragonard, is a symbol of the liberated and daring spirit of the 1920s. The era's influence is evident in the performer's flapper-style haircut, bold makeup, and the suggestive pose she strikes. The Piccadilly Hotel, located in the heart of London, was a hotspot for cabaret shows and jazz music during the 1920s. 'Playtime' was one of the most popular productions to grace its stage, attracting audiences from all walks of life with its daring and provocative performances. Costume designer Dolly Tree, a pioneer of the era's fashion scene, created stunning and innovative outfits for the show's performers. The Fragonard Girl's costume, with its intricate beading and fringing, is a testament to her skill and creativity. This photograph, taken in 1925, captures a moment in time when jazz music, cabaret performances, and the liberated spirit of the 1920s came together to create an unforgettable experience. The Fragonard Girl scene from 'Playtime' at the Piccadilly Hotel remains an iconic representation of this era and continues to inspire and captivate audiences today.
